WebThe Freedom to Display the American Flag Act of 2006, signed by President George W. Bush, prohibits association-governed communities from preventing their members from displaying the U.S. flag. Web10 jun. 2024 · The flag should never be carried flat or horizontally, but always aloft and free. The flag should never be fastened, displayed, used, or stored so that it might … Web11 nov. 2024 · If the flag is against a wall or hanging over a window, is should be displayed flat with the union at the top left corner.
